As you pass the Kanda Ela Reservoir, you can enter the Kanda Ela National Park, a forested area created by the Forest Department for education.It is a very beautiful and knowledgeable place.I will mention a small part of the knowledge I gained from that place.The park is located at an altitude of more than 1900 m above sea level.Located at a height of over 1900m above sea level, the park has a circular walking path of about 1.5 km where you will be educated on various aspects of re forestation, planting trees, logging, weaving industry, village life and chena cultivation, etc. in different segments.The path is through thick forest cover with life size replicas of people and buildings. The full walk through though would take about 1 – 1.5 hours.
